RELIABLE and Competitive Worldwide Boosting customer competitiveness MITRAC 3000 stands for innovation, know-how and customer support that enables you to optimize cuttingedge converters, drives and train control and management systems for locomotives and high speed powerheads worldwide. The synergy of high modularity, efficiency, reliability and excellent maintainability provides low life cycle costs and dependable revenue service. Exceeding expectations At the Competence Centre, we surpass even the most demanding customers needs. How? By leveraging our unrivalled technical expertise, superior skills and extensive experience in designing, testing and commissioning high power propulsion systems. Driven by reliability Providing best-in-class reliability and availability are key and constant objectives. We continuously monitor and seize every opportunity to enhance our products performance and reliability. Areas for improvement are identified and addressed at the source. In the event of a malfunction, our well-engineered redundancy architectures minimize disruptions, allowing locomotives to complete the journey as planned. Committed to sustainable mobility Our products integrate the latest technologies to provide both high performance and high power efficiency. Product innovations and thorough testing and simulations under realistic conditions enable us to continuously improve our environmental footprint. 4 Reliable and Competitive Worldwide

MITRAC Powerlab Zürich Power laboratory We operate one of the world s most advanced power laboratories. Opened in 2009, the almost 1,400-square-metre powerlab is used to test new propulsion technologies, products and systems of all power ranges under real operating conditions. An additional 320-square-metre area is available for motors, loads and transformers. The power supply infrastructure provides high voltage AC and DC power for testing with any common railway electrification system worldwide. The infrastructure is designed to conserve energy by, for example, converting mechanical motor power back to electric power and using an efficient cooling system. For complete testing of diesel-electric propulsion systems, dedicated diesel generators are located adjacent to the laboratory building. Outside the lab, electrified test tracks are available for commissioning and testing complete rail vehicles. OUR EXPERIENCE Our global leadership in propulsion and control solutions is based on more than 40 years of three-phase propulsion system experience and 25 years of GTO and IGBT semiconductor technology expertise. Important historic milestones Year Vehicle Key innovation Year Vehicle Key innovation 1970 and 1974 DE 2500 World s first thyristor-based traction converters with 3-phase asynchronous motors (diesel-electric and electric locomotives) 1979 DB BR 120 World s first commercial electric locomotive with 3-phase propulsion delivering 5.6 MW 1990 SBB Re 460 Lok 2000 1996 1996 Trenitalia E464 Indian Railways WAG9 / WAG9H World s first high power traction converter in 3-level circuit with 4.5 kv / 2.5 ka GTOs GTO propulsion for largest locomotive fleet ordered.
